candyman93 Posted July 4, 2020 Author Share Posted July 4, 2020 (edited) Quote One source said he believed it's likely that teams will go to camp with 80-man rosters, and another source said it's "definitely not 90." A third league source said he has "heard lots of discussion about 75 players potentially instead of 90," especially with the reduction in preseason games and teams not needing as many players for camp as normal. There also are increasing questions from league sources about whether camp can start on time with the number of coronavirus cases around the country spiking. The NFL also is considering expanding its practice squads to 16-20 players in the event of a coronavirus outbreak; if there were one, teams would have a deeper stash of players to activate to play games.
